What is the role of consensus in the Bitcoin network?

Can you explain the significance of consensus in the Bitcoin network and how it affects the functioning of the cryptocurrency?
5 answers
- MorisanderFeb 17, 2026 · 2 months agoConsensus plays a crucial role in the Bitcoin network as it ensures the validity and security of transactions. In simple terms, consensus refers to the agreement among participants in the network on the state of the blockchain. This agreement is reached through a process called mining, where miners compete to solve complex mathematical problems. Once a miner solves a problem, they add a new block to the blockchain and receive a reward in the form of newly minted bitcoins. Consensus is important because it prevents double-spending and maintains the integrity of the decentralized system.
